Process and system for the annotation of machine-generated directions with easily recognized landmarks and other relevant information
First Claim
1. A method for generating directions for a travel route, the method comprising:
- obtaining a geographic location of a selected area along the travel route;
identifying a selected establishment within a configurable distance from the geographic location of the selected area, the configurable distance being configured as a function of at least an attribute of the selected establishment, wherein the attribute concerns at least the size of the selected establishment; and
generating the directions that incorporate an identification of the selected establishment.
3 Assignments
0 Petitions
Accused Products
Abstract
A method and system for annotating machine-generated directions for a route with retain signage and other readily-recognizable landmarks. The coordinates of a selected area of the route are obtained. The selected area of the route can be any portion of the route from an origination point to a destination point. However, the coordinates of turns along the route as well as points along long stretches of road in the route are of particular interest. Once the coordinates of interest are determined, a database is scanned to identify one or more landmarks or establishments within a definable zone about the coordinates. A scoring algorithm may be employed to score the qualifying landmarks and establishments using factors such as distance, orientation and visibility. Alternatively, a radius search may be performed for establishments that lie within a given radius of the user'"'"'s geocoded location along the travel route, said given radius may be determined by an expansion factor. Means may be employed to limit the number of landmarks or establishments to be annotated. Once the landmarks or establishments are decided upon, driving directions are generated that incorporate one or more of the landmarks or establishments within the zone in the instructions regarding navigation of the route.
282 Citations
45 Claims
-
1. A method for generating directions for a travel route, the method comprising:
-
obtaining a geographic location of a selected area along the travel route;
identifying a selected establishment within a configurable distance from the geographic location of the selected area, the configurable distance being configured as a function of at least an attribute of the selected establishment, wherein the attribute concerns at least the size of the selected establishment; and
generating the directions that incorporate an identification of the selected establishment.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 10, 11, 12)
-
-
9. A method for generating directions for a travel route, the method comprising:
-
obtaining a geographic location of a selected area along the travel route;
identifying one or more landmarks corresponding to the geographic location of the selected area;
randomly selecting at least one of the one or more landmarks; and
generating the directions that incorporate an identification of the at least one of the one or more landmarks.
-
-
13. A method for generating directions for a travel route, the method comprising:
-
obtaining a geographic location of a selected area along the travel route;
identifying at least one zone proximate to the selected area, the size of the zone being configurable as a function of at least an attribute of the travel route in the selected area, wherein the size of the zone is defined by a radius determined by an expansion factor;
identifying one or more landmarks within the zone;
deciding upon at least one of the one or more landmarks in the directions; and
generating the directions that incorporate an identification of the at least one of the one or more landmarks. - View Dependent Claims (14, 15)
-
-
16. A method for generating driving directions for a route from a first location to a second location, the method comprising:
-
maintaining a database, the database comprising entities that are referenced by geocoded locations;
identifying one or more entities from the database within a configurable radius of a geocoded location of the traveler along the route, the geocoded locations of the one or more entities being defined by different zones, each zone having a size which is a function of at least an attribute of the entity defined by the zone; and
generating the driving directions that incorporate an identification of at least one of the one or more entities. - View Dependent Claims (17, 18, 19, 20, 21, 22)
-
-
23. A method for generating driving directions for a route from a first location to a second location, the method comprising the steps of:
-
a) obtaining coordinates proximate to a portion of the route corresponding to an appropriate location to confirm that a traveler is proceeding along the prescribed route;
b) identifying one or more establishments within a definable zone about the coordinates;
c) deciding upon at least one of the one or more establishments within the coordinate zone to include in the driving directions; and
d) generating driving directions that incorporate an identification of the at least one of the one or more establishments within the coordinate zone in the instructions regarding traversal of the route.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
-
34. A method for generating driving directions for a route from a first location to a second location, the method comprising the steps of:
-
obtaining coordinates proximate to a portion of the route corresponding to an appropriate location to confirm that a traveler is proceeding along the route;
maintaining a database of establishments, the database including a plurality of records indicating establishments that have entered into a financial relationship with a directions provider to promote the establishments through the provision of driving directions;
identifying one or more establishments from the database within a definable zone about the coordinates;
deciding upon at least one of the one or more establishments within the definable zone to include in the driving directions; and
generating the driving directions that incorporate an identification of the at least one of the one or more establishments within the definable zone. - View Dependent Claims (35, 36, 37, 38, 39, 40)
-
-
41. A method for generating driving directions for a route from a first location to a second location, the method comprising:
-
obtaining coordinates proximate to a portion of the route corresponding to an appropriate location to confirm that a traveler is proceeding along the route;
maintaining a database of location-specific information objects, the database comprising data regarding the geocoded position of said information objects, said information objects being assigned respective expiration times after which said information objects become ineffective;
identifying one or more said information objects from the database within a definable zone about the coordinates;
deciding upon at least one of the one or more said information objects within the definable zone to include in the driving directions; and
generating driving directions that incorporate an identification of the at least one of the one or more said information objects within the definable zone. - View Dependent Claims (42, 43, 44, 45)
-
Specification